Output f71b221b7389f4bfcba9cfe25da1db249cf08fcf22e946bb1af622d6a10a94ad:0

value
999156
script pubkey
OP_0 OP_PUSHBYTES_20 4d214104383be5d571cf60fc80b6e560ee3835a1
address
tb1qf5s5zppc80ja2uw0vr7gpdh9vrhrsddpmueeyk
transaction
f71b221b7389f4bfcba9cfe25da1db249cf08fcf22e946bb1af622d6a10a94ad
confirmations
81477
spent
true